Hindimp3mobi did not license music from T-Series (the film’s music label). Instead, it operated through copyright infringement. The process was simple:

For millions of Indian users with slow 2G connections (and later 3G), Hindimp3mobi was faster, cheaper (free vs. a ₹120-150 CD), and more convenient than going to a store. The site was part of a larger network including Djmaza, SongsPK, Mr-Jatt, and Webmusic.

Hindimp3mobi was a classic example of a “MP3 blog” or “ripping site.” Its primary function was to convert audio from original CDs or other sources into compressed MP3 files (typically at 128kbps or 192kbps) and host them for direct download.
